Fuzzy Comprehensive Evaluation of the Stability of High-Cutting Regional Slope
Authors: Qingwen Ma [email protected], Yongxing Jiang, and Xiangli QianAuthor Affiliations
Publication: ICTE 2013: Safety, Speediness, Intelligence, Low-Carbon, Innovation
Abstract
A method is introduced to evaluate the stability of high-cutting regional slope, and this method is suitable for the highway that is in operation. Taking the high slope along Huo highway in SanMenXia section for example, through field investigation and analysis of the existing geological data, a kind of index system that uses fuzzy comprehensive evaluates the stability of regional high slope and considers geological structure characteristics U1, landform U2, protective measures U3, and other influence factors U4 was confirmed. The analytical hierarchy process was used to determine the evaluation index weights of the index system, according to the method secondary fuzzy comprehensive evaluation and the principle of maximum membership degree, a model for fuzzy comprehensive evaluation for the stability of hig- cutting regional slope was established.
